资源列表
hmac_sha1.tar
- 以C语言撰写的HMAC SHA1加密演算法,附上测试用的scr ipt-Written in C language HMAC SHA1 encryption algorithm, with a test using the scr ipt
MD5
- java MD5加密解密 jar包-jar package java MD5 encryption and decryption
d3des
- 3DES 3DESMAC pboc 算3des MAC-3DES 3DESMAC pboc operator 3des MAC
AES
- C++实现的AES加密算法,接口简单,可以直接使用-C++ implementation of the AES encryption algorithm, the interface is simple, can be used directly
injectso
- linux 上的注入技术,实现了想目标继承注入一个so中的函数-linux on the injection technique to achieve the function of a so want to target inheritance injection
sm4
- SMS4 algorithm implemented---SMS4算法实现-SMS4 algorithm implemented--- SMS4 algorithm
Centralized-symmetric-key
- 完成集中式对称密钥的分配工作 说明:作为通讯的双方A和B,都已经分别和KDC拥有会话密钥Ka和Kb,但A、B之间事先没有保密通道,需要依赖KDC为它们的会话分配临时密钥Ks。在完成会话密钥Ks的分配后,A利用Ks对特定文件(test-1.txt)进行加密,并发送给B;B利用Ks对密文进行解密,并对比解密后的明文信息同原来的文件是否一致。 要求: (1)JAVA语言编程实现,基于DES完成对称密码技术的加/解密(JAVA有库函数支持); (2)通信内容为一文本文件(test-1.t
tea.tar
- 完成tea的加密,解密.他实现了,TEA的加密,解密,并写好了头文件-I write a code, it can do something about the tea.
Vulnerability_CVE-2012-0056
- CVE-2012-0056是一个严重的Linux漏洞,可以导致本地用户提权。该漏洞同样影响了Android系统,这里给出利用代码~-CVE-2012-0056 Linux is a serious flaw that can cause local user privilege escalation. The vulnerability also affects the Android system, use the code given here ~
sha256
- s加密sghshrova;kfdngvajkrgal(rg a s th wr 6y h j fh k r 7t g h sg fs n yt h xv)
3.c
- 实现一种最基本的加密解密,是基于C语言的一种,并没有使用什么模式(To achieve one of the most basic encryption and decryption)
crc-32
- 计算xk+1除CRC-32后的余式,k从1到32768
